According to A tweet from Birdman, once you upgrade to 2.2 the 2.1 SBF does not work anymore??

This is definitely true with a sticky in the Droid X forum to back it up. Do not try flashing the 2.1 SBF after an OTA upgrade to 2.2. It will brick, the bootloader has been resigned to prevent 2.1 from loading.

I used the method in the video. However many users attempting it found that you wanted a specific version of the Motorola USB drivers for it to work. I'll see if I can find that download.

EDIT: Yep, here: http://www.motorola.com/staticfiles/Support/Experiences/Global_Drivers/USB_Drivers_bit_4.7.1.zip I also set my droid to USB mass storage mode while it was attached with debug enabled to run the script.

Stop doing the doroot batch file and do it by hand. Open the batch file and send the adb commands one at a time, or follow the adb droid x root ota 2.2(droid 2 method).
Environment variables and pathing can make the batch file falsely finish and say you are rooted.

Follow this guide for the commands. If you did not set your environment path variable, dump everything into your adb directory.

btw: you can paste into a command shell to make it very easy to do it manual

Click on the upper left icon on the command shell window, referred to as the system menu, and along with Move, Size, and so on, you'll see a sub menu called Edit. Click on that, and you'll find Copy, Paste and other clipboard related commands.
